Small dream meaning

Dreaming of someone or something appearing smaller than usual often reflects underlying emotions of insignificance, helplessness, or feelings of unworthiness. This imagery may indicate a desire to diminish the perceived power or influence of another, suggesting an urge to "bring them down to size." Alternatively, it could highlight a situation in which you or someone close to you exhibits an inflated sense of self-importance, signaling a need for humility or a lesson in perspective.

Dreaming of yourself as small while others appear of normal size often reflects feelings of low self-esteem or a sense of powerlessness in your waking life. This imagery may indicate that you feel marginalized or overlooked, as if your presence and contributions are not fully acknowledged. Such dreams can serve as a prompt to explore your self-worth and the dynamics of your relationships, encouraging you to recognize and assert your value.
